前言
今天试运行产品顾问发布的demo,途中遇到一些问题进行解决。
重新找回MySQL密码
第一步:在命令行输入net stop mysql命令关闭mysql服务;
(没有配置环境需要在bin目录下进行命令行操作,如果无服务名则需要去计算机管理里面的服务确认mysql服务的名字,如我的是MySQL80)
第二步:使用–skip-grant-tables选项启动mysql服务(服务器将不加载权限判断,任何用户 都能访问数据库);
在命令行输入 mysqld --skip-grant-tables;
命令运行之后,用户无法再输入指令,此时如果在任务管理器中可以看到名称为 mysqld的进程,则表示可以用root用户登录服务器了;
第三步:打开另一个命令行窗口,输入不加密码的登录命令;
mysql -u root;
登录成功后可以使用update语句修改密码;
修改完成后,必须使用flush privileges语句刷新权限表,这样新的密码才能生效;
第四步:将输入mysqld --skip-grant-tables命令的命令行窗口关闭,接下来就可以使用新密码登录mysql服务器了;
嫌麻烦的话,最简单的是卸载重装MySQL。
添加getter和setter
右键选择generate
选择getter and setter
之后选中方法进行添加就OK了
运行
听小组已经运行成功的成员说把index.html从templates下挪到 static 下,运行无报错。
从终端输入nmp.start
网页localhost成功打开。
除了用户名和密码啥也没有